Network junction box
Technical Field
The utility model belongs to the technical field of network devices, and particularly relates to a network junction box.
Background
As networks have become popular, network junction boxes are known as an interface for connecting a network, which is hidden in a wall or ground, to a user's computer. The general network junction box comprises a box body, a base arranged at the bottom of the box body and an interface arranged on the front surface of the box body.
The existing network junction box is characterized in that the box body and the base are often integrally formed or fixedly connected through bolts, the design enables personnel to become complicated and complicated in disassembly operation between the box body and the base, and an external auxiliary tool is often needed, so that the electronic element inside the junction box is inconvenient to overhaul and maintain, and a new network junction box is needed to be additionally designed to solve the problem.

Examples
Referring to fig. 1 to 3, the present utility model provides a technical solution: the utility model provides a network terminal box, including base 100 and box body 200, be connected through mosaic structure 400 between box body 200 both sides and the base 100, mosaic structure 400 includes side piece 401, movable piece 402, kerve 403, draw-in groove 404, dop 405, press head 406 and press groove 407, movable piece 402 activity sets up in the inside of side piece 401, under the normality, dop 405 of movable piece 402 bottom can block with draw-in groove 404, thereby be connected base 100 and box body 200, the personnel can promote movable piece 402 through pressing press head 406 and remove, thereby drive dop 405 no longer block with draw-in groove 404, the fixation between base 100 and the box body 200 is relieved at this moment, can easily accomplish the dismantlement to the two.
In this embodiment, preferably, the outer end section of the clamping head 405 is an arc surface, and the inner wall of one side of the bottom slot 403 is an arc surface, so that when the base 100 and the box 200 are connected, the clamping head 405 at the bottom of the movable sheet 402 needs to be inserted into the bottom of the bottom slot 403 from top to bottom, and in this process, the clamping head 405 and the arc surface of the bottom slot 403 can be mutually extruded, so as to push the movable sheet 402 to autonomously move, and the clamping head 405 can be smoothly clamped into the inside of the clamping slot 404.
In this embodiment, preferably, the surface of the case 200 is provided with a reset groove 408 located on the inner side of the movable plate 402, a spring is fixed between the reset groove 408 and the movable plate 402, when the movable plate 402 moves inward, the spring is compressed, and then the reset of the movable plate 402 can be completed by the resilience force of the spring, and at the same time, the chuck 405 can be stably engaged with the clamping groove 404.
In this embodiment, preferably, a guide assembly 409 is disposed between the case 200 and the movable plate 402, where the guide assembly 409 includes a guide bar 4091 and a guide hole 4092, and when the movable plate 402 slides, the guide bar 4091 slides relatively to the guide hole 4092, so as to guide the movable plate 402, so that the movable plate 402 can slide stably.
In this embodiment, preferably, the cover assembly 500 is disposed on the outer side of the side block 401, and the cover assembly 500 includes a cover 501, an inner molding 502 and a chute 503, where the cover 501 will cover the outer side of the pressing slot 407 in normal state, so as to prevent a person from touching the pressing head 406 inside the pressing slot 407 by mistake, and the inner molding 502 is fixed on the inner surface of the cover 501 and slidingly connected with the chute 503 on the outer surface of the side block 401, so that the cover 501 can be opened or closed freely.
In this embodiment, preferably, the inner groove 504 is formed on the inner side of the chute 503, the inner end of the inner molding 502 extends into the inner groove 504 and is fixed with the anti-falling bar 505, and the inner molding 502 and the anti-falling bar 505 form a T-shaped structure to prevent the inner molding 502 from falling off.
In this embodiment, preferably, the rubber strips 506 contacting with the anti-falling strips 505 are provided in the inner groove 504, so that friction is increased, the cover 501 cannot move autonomously, and the toggle groove 507 is provided on the outer surface of the cover 501.
In this embodiment, preferably, the front surface of the case 200 is provided with the interface 300, and the bottom of the base 100 is provided with a rubber anti-slip pad, which plays a role in anti-slip.
